maccjo,

Heh..I don't know about being "right on"...the better half doesn't seem to think so ;) More like "never right"!

I've done fine with the Impact Cosmic, Scout Mountain Bighorn Slider and HHA Optimizer Light 5000 on the 2004 singles and the I have the HHA on a P40 DC with plenty of adjustment left. Spott Hoggs & Copper Johns seem to have plenty of adjustment as well for the singles or duals.

I've got the Mag 50 on my Ultratec. Works good. First time using a scope and really don't notice a difference. Probably just me. The lense can be removed easy enough to shoot with out. I do have a minor problem that I have to contact Tox on, the lockdowns do come loose. I've shot Tox sights for 4 years now and still like them. I'm using a Hybrid V for hunting still.
